scattered motor, new plans
scattered my motor the other night at 6700 rpm. wasnt too fun. i know this sounds crazy but the 2nd and 3rd rods from the front of the motor let loose and completely wiped the block. the rods took out a section from about the bottom of the motor mount down the side clear to the bottom of the pan, across the bottom and up the other side. its insane. i think if the heads werent on it, the block would be in half. but i need to know what i wanna do. i either want to build a iron block 408, or just get a stock ls1 block and fill it with forged internals and then spray like a 200-250 shot on it. what would u do?

wasnt spraying. we pulled the motor tonite, broke the block about 3 inches up on both sides and clear down both sides of the pan, 2 pistons disapeared, 3 rods were broken, and one bent about 10 degrees. it was basically heads and cam car, lt's, intake,car made around 400, but new setup will be higher compression, around 11.3:1 with a whole lotta n2o.
